What is Chang Jia M&E Engineering PB Ratio?

Chang Jia M&E Engineering ROCO:4550 58 PB Ratio is 0.98 as of Jul. 26, 2026, which is 8% below its 10-year median of 1.07. GuruFocus rates ROCO:4550 with a GF Score™ of 58/100 and a GF Value™ of NT$17.58 (Significantly Overvalued). The stock has 4 warning signs investors should review. Among 1,722 Construction companies, Chang Jia M&E Engineering ranks better than 62.14% on this metric.

The PB Ratio, or Price-to-Book ratio, or Price/Book, is a financial ratio used to compare a company's market price to its Book Value per Share. As of today (2026-07-26), Chang Jia M&E Engineering's share price is NT$24.60. Chang Jia M&E Engineering's Book Value per Share for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2025 was NT$25.10. Hence, Chang Jia M&E Engineering's PB Ratio of today is 0.98.

Back to Basics: PB Ratio


Chang Jia M&E Engineering  (ROCO:4550) PB Ratio Explanation

Unlike valuation ratios relative to the earning power such as PE Ratio, PE Ratio without NRI, PS Ratio, Price-to-Operating-Cash-Flow , or Price-to-Free-Cash-Flow, the PB Ratio measures the valuation of the stock relative to the underlying asset of the company.

The PB Ratio works the best for the businesses that earn most of their profit from their assets, e.g. banks and insurance companies.


Be Aware

Some businesses have very light assets, such as software companies or insurance agencies. The PB Ratio does not work well for these companies. Some companies even have negative equity, so the PB Ratio cannot be applied to them.

Chang Jia M&E Engineering Business Description

Address Number 1, Lane 10, Jihu Road, 8th Floor, Neihu District, Taipei, TWN, 114
Chang Jia M&E Engineering Corp is a Taiwan-based company engaged in the planning, design and engineering contracting of electrical, drainage and air conditioning equipment for various commercial buildings and factories, as well as the operation of sports centers and the import and export of the above-mentioned equipment.
